241 looping_count
242 
243 			A count value that indicates the number of times the
244 			producer of entries into this Ring has looped around the
245 			ring.
246 
247 			At initialization time, this value is set to 0. On the
248 			first loop, this value is set to 1. After the max value is
249 			reached allowed by the number of bits for this field, the
250 			count value continues with 0 again.
251 
252 
253 
254 			In case SW is the consumer of the ring entries, it can
255 			use this field to figure out up to where the producer of
256 			entries has created new entries. This eliminates the need to
257 			check where the head pointer' of the ring is located once
258 			the SW starts processing an interrupt indicating that new
259 			entries have been put into this ring...
260 
261 
262 
263 			Also note that SW if it wants only needs to look at the
264 			LSB bit of this count value.
265 
266 			<legal all>
